Madam Speaker, I thank my friend, French Hill, for yielding. Families, workers, and small businesses are hurting from the highest inflation in over 40 years, and in Southern California where I am from, everything is more expensive. Inflation doesn't discriminate. It impacts every American and hurts small businesses and workers with less income the most. For example, Raul and Rosalina Davis, owners of Tlaquepaque Restaurant in Placentia, in my district, told my office: ``Higher gas prices and issues with our supply chain are leading to increasing costs from everything from beverages to meat for ingredients, to workforce shortages. As a restaurant, we run our small business with very tight revenue margins, and a small change in prices can really hurt our bottom line. If we have to pass on higher costs to our customers, it puts us in a tough place when we are competing against bigger restaurants that can absorb higher costs.'' While the Biden administration calls inflation temporary and seeks to redefine the long-established meaning of a recession, I have introduced bills to combat inflationary spending, lower taxes on Californians, and support job creators.
